Kobe Holds Onto Lead In NBA All-Star Voting

NEW YORK (CBS SPORTS) - In the third round of NBA All-Star ballot returns, Kobe Bryant remains on top as the leading vote-getter, ahead of LeBron James. Kobe checks in with 1,177,456 votes, ahead of LeBron, who has 1,151,304. Kevin Durant remains third with 1,088,797, ahead of Carmelo Anthony, who is at 1,054,099.

Overall, nothing has really changed since the first returns released December 13. The current East starters remain the same as the first returns, with Rajon Rondo, Dwyane Wade, LeBron, Carmelo and Kevin Garnett starting.

The West is unchaged as well, with Chris Paul, Kobe, Durant, Blake Griffin and Dwight Howard staying the first five.
